excel怎么算成绩 学分

excel怎么算成绩 学分

一、EXCEL计算成绩与学分的方法

设置课程表、利用SUMPRODUCT函数进行计算、设置权重值。在Excel中计算成绩和学分并不复杂,关键在于设置一个合理的课程表,并利用SUMPRODUCT函数进行计算。首先,你需要建立一个包含课程名称、学分和成绩的表格。然后,通过SUMPRODUCT函数来计算加权平均成绩,从而得出最终的结果。接下来,我们详细介绍其中的步骤。

二、创建课程表

在Excel中,首先需要创建一个课程表。这个表格通常包括以下几列:课程名称、学分、成绩。通过这样一个简单的表格,我们可以将每门课程的成绩和学分对应起来,方便后续的计算。

表格结构

  1. 课程名称
  2. 学分
  3. 成绩

例如:

课程名称 学分 成绩
数学 3 85
物理 4 90
化学 2 78

数据录入

将每门课程的名称、学分和成绩分别输入到相应的单元格中。确保数据的准确性,因为后续的计算将基于这些数据进行。

三、利用SUMPRODUCT函数计算加权平均成绩

SUMPRODUCT函数是Excel中一个非常强大的函数,适用于各种加权计算。在计算成绩和学分时,SUMPRODUCT函数可以帮助我们轻松地完成这一任务。

SUMPRODUCT函数的公式

在Excel中,SUMPRODUCT函数的基本语法如下:

=SUMPRODUCT(数组1, 数组2, ...)

在我们的例子中,数组1是学分,数组2是成绩。具体的公式如下:

=SUMPRODUCT(B2:B4, C2:C4) / SUM(B2:B4)

公式解释

  • SUMPRODUCT(B2:B4, C2:C4): 计算每门课程的学分与成绩的乘积之和。
  • SUM(B2:B4): 计算所有课程的学分之和。
  • / SUM(B2:B4): 将乘积之和除以学分之和,得到加权平均成绩。

输入公式

将上述公式输入到Excel的一个空单元格中,例如D5。按下回车键,Excel将自动计算出加权平均成绩。

四、设置权重值

在某些情况下,不同课程的权重可能不同。例如,某些核心课程的权重可能高于其他课程。在这种情况下,我们需要在计算中考虑权重值。

添加权重列

在课程表中,添加一个新的列,用于存储每门课程的权重。例如:

课程名称 学分 成绩 权重
数学 3 85 1.2
物理 4 90 1.0
化学 2 78 0.8

修改SUMPRODUCT公式

在考虑权重值的情况下,SUMPRODUCT公式需要进行相应的修改。具体的公式如下:

=SUMPRODUCT(B2:B4, C2:C4, D2:D4) / SUMPRODUCT(B2:B4, D2:D4)

公式解释

  • SUMPRODUCT(B2:B4, C2:C4, D2:D4): 计算每门课程的学分、成绩和权重的乘积之和。
  • SUMPRODUCT(B2:B4, D2:D4): 计算所有课程的学分与权重的乘积之和。
  • / SUMPRODUCT(B2:B4, D2:D4): 将乘积之和除以学分与权重的乘积之和,得到加权平均成绩。

输入公式

将上述公式输入到Excel的一个空单元格中,例如E5。按下回车键,Excel将自动计算出考虑权重值后的加权平均成绩。

五、使用IF函数处理特殊情况

在实际应用中,我们可能会遇到一些特殊情况,例如某门课程的成绩不计入总成绩。此时,我们可以使用IF函数进行条件判断,确保计算结果的准确性。

IF函数的基本语法

IF函数的基本语法如下:

=IF(条件, 值1, 值2)

应用IF函数

例如,如果某门课程的成绩低于60分,则该课程的成绩不计入总成绩。我们可以将IF函数嵌套到SUMPRODUCT公式中,具体的公式如下:

=SUMPRODUCT(B2:B4, IF(C2:C4>=60, C2:C4, 0)) / SUMPRODUCT(B2:B4, IF(C2:C4>=60, 1, 0))

公式解释

  • IF(C2:C4>=60, C2:C4, 0): 如果成绩大于或等于60分,则返回成绩;否则返回0。
  • IF(C2:C4>=60, 1, 0): 如果成绩大于或等于60分,则返回1;否则返回0。
  • SUMPRODUCT(B2:B4, IF(C2:C4>=60, C2:C4, 0)): 计算符合条件的学分与成绩的乘积之和。
  • SUMPRODUCT(B2:B4, IF(C2:C4>=60, 1, 0)): 计算符合条件的学分之和。
  • / SUMPRODUCT(B2:B4, IF(C2:C4>=60, 1, 0)): 将乘积之和除以符合条件的学分之和,得到加权平均成绩。

输入公式

将上述公式输入到Excel的一个空单元格中,例如F5。按下回车键,Excel将自动计算出考虑特殊情况后的加权平均成绩。

六、利用条件格式进行可视化

为了更直观地查看成绩和学分,我们可以利用Excel的条件格式功能进行可视化。条件格式可以根据单元格的值自动应用不同的格式,使数据更加清晰易读。

添加条件格式

  1. 选择要应用条件格式的单元格区域,例如C2:C4。
  2. 在Excel的“开始”选项卡中,点击“条件格式”按钮。
  3. 选择“新建规则”,在弹出的对话框中选择“基于各自值设置单元格格式”。
  4. 设置格式规则,例如将成绩低于60分的单元格填充为红色,将成绩高于90分的单元格填充为绿色。
  5. 点击“确定”按钮,应用条件格式。

可视化效果

应用条件格式后,Excel将自动根据单元格的值调整格式。这样,用户可以更直观地查看每门课程的成绩和学分,快速识别需要关注的课程。

七、使用数据验证确保数据准确性

为了确保数据的准确性,我们可以使用Excel的数据验证功能。数据验证可以限制用户输入的值,避免输入错误的数据。

设置数据验证

  1. 选择要应用数据验证的单元格区域,例如B2:B4(学分列)。
  2. 在Excel的“数据”选项卡中,点击“数据验证”按钮。
  3. 在弹出的对话框中,选择“设置”选项卡。
  4. 在“允许”下拉列表中选择“整数”,在“数据”下拉列表中选择“大于”,在“最小值”框中输入“0”。
  5. 点击“确定”按钮,应用数据验证。

数据验证效果

应用数据验证后,用户只能输入大于0的整数作为学分。如果输入的值不符合条件,Excel将弹出警告提示,防止错误数据的输入。

八、使用数组公式提高计算效率

在处理大量数据时,使用数组公式可以提高计算效率。数组公式可以一次性计算多个值,减少公式的数量和计算时间。

数组公式的基本语法

数组公式的基本语法如下:

{=公式}

注意,数组公式需要在输入公式后按下Ctrl+Shift+Enter键,而不是普通的回车键。

应用数组公式

例如,我们可以使用数组公式计算总成绩和总学分。具体的公式如下:

{=SUM(B2:B4 * C2:C4)}

公式解释

  • B2:B4 * C2:C4: 计算每门课程的学分与成绩的乘积。
  • SUM(B2:B4 * C2:C4): 计算所有课程的学分与成绩的乘积之和。

输入数组公式

选择一个空单元格,例如G5。输入上述公式后,按下Ctrl+Shift+Enter键。Excel将自动计算总成绩,并在公式两端添加花括号{},表示这是一个数组公式。

九、使用VLOOKUP函数查找数据

在某些情况下,我们可能需要根据课程名称查找对应的学分和成绩。此时,可以使用Excel的VLOOKUP函数进行查找。

VLOOKUP函数的基本语法

VLOOKUP函数的基本语法如下:

=VLOOKUP(查找值, 查找范围, 列序号, [匹配类型])

应用VLOOKUP函数

例如,我们需要查找“物理”课程的学分和成绩。具体的公式如下:

=VLOOKUP("物理", A2:C4, 2, FALSE)

公式解释

  • "物理": 查找的课程名称。
  • A2:C4: 查找范围,包括课程名称、学分和成绩。
  • 2: 返回查找值所在行的第二列(学分)。
  • FALSE: 精确匹配。

输入VLOOKUP公式

选择一个空单元格,例如H5。输入上述公式后,按下回车键。Excel将自动查找“物理”课程的学分并返回结果。

十、总结

通过上述步骤,我们详细介绍了如何在Excel中计算成绩和学分。首先,创建一个包含课程名称、学分和成绩的课程表;其次,利用SUMPRODUCT函数计算加权平均成绩;然后,设置权重值,考虑特殊情况;接着,利用条件格式进行可视化,使用数据验证确保数据准确性;最后,使用数组公式和VLOOKUP函数提高计算效率。

这些方法不仅适用于学生成绩的计算,也可以应用于其他需要加权计算的数据处理场景。通过合理地使用Excel的各种功能,我们可以大大提高数据处理的效率和准确性。

相关问答FAQs:

1. 如何在Excel中计算成绩和学分?
在Excel中计算成绩和学分,可以使用数学函数和数据分析工具。首先,将学生的成绩和对应的学分列在Excel表格中。然后,使用SUM函数计算总学分,使用AVERAGE函数计算平均成绩。还可以使用VLOOKUP函数来查找某个特定成绩对应的学分。通过这些函数的组合使用,你可以轻松地计算出成绩和学分。

2. 如何在Excel中计算加权成绩?
如果你需要根据学分来计算加权成绩,可以使用SUMPRODUCT函数。首先,在Excel中创建两列,一列是成绩,一列是对应的学分。然后,在另一列中使用SUMPRODUCT函数将成绩和学分相乘,并将结果相加,最后再除以总学分。这样就可以得到加权成绩了。

3. 如何使用Excel进行成绩分析?
使用Excel进行成绩分析可以帮助你更好地理解学生的表现。你可以使用条件格式化功能来对成绩进行可视化处理,例如设置成绩范围的颜色标记,以便直观地了解学生的优劣势。此外,你还可以使用图表功能来绘制成绩分布图,以便更直观地分析成绩的分布情况。同时,你还可以使用数据透视表来对成绩进行汇总和分析,从不同的维度进行对比和筛选,以便更全面地了解学生成绩的情况。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4624396

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部